This thing does exactly what it says it does. It lacks proper instructions, so at first I thought I had to fill it before putting it into the pen. You can actually install this into your pen before filling, then just dip your nib into the ink and twist the plunger up. It sucks it right up through the nib; nifty! A quick wipe down with some blotting paper to absorb the ink and you’re good to go! (I use note cards as blotting paper since they’re cheap as dirt and super absorbent. I don’t know if thats bad practice or anything, but it works for me)

Fits my Lamy Safari perfectly, just make sure you put the plunger in the down position by turning red knob, before trying to draw ink into the pen.

Pros: does not leak, allows me to use Noodles ink (which is a great mfg of ink) and easy to use and install. Cons: does not hold as much ink as a cartridge so I end up refilling it about once a week or so. All in all, I like it and have been using it for 2 months now with no problems. I have no reason to go back to cartridges, so I will keep using it!
